The Community

Life in
Rockwood

Settled in the early 1800s along the Eramosa River, Rockwood is a village that has never lost its character. Beautiful limestone buildings line its streets, and the Rockwood Conservation Area — famously painted by the Group of Seven — is moments from your door.


With towering limestone cliffs, over 200 glacial potholes, a network of 12 caves, and some of the oldest trees in Ontario, the conservation area draws over 65,000 visitors annually. Population capped at ~6,000 by design, Rockwood's charm is protected. Fifteen minutes from Guelph, with easy GTA access via Highway 401.
